The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. Cambria Friesland Middle/High School is a public school for students in grades 6-12 in Cambria, WI and is served by the Cambria-Friesland School District in Wisconsin. The school has a total enrollment of 160 and maintains a student-teacher ratio of 11:1. Academic records show that 22% of students achieve proficiency in math, and 17% are proficient in reading. Cambria Friesland Middle/High School has received feedback and ratings, with a Niche grade of C+ and a GreatSchools Rating of 4 out of 10. The average GPA is 3.65, the graduation rate is 84.5%, and the average ACT score is 25.
